Come and Try Water Aerobics
Aqua Aerobics classes are designed to cater for all fitness levels, abilities and ages. It's a great cardiovascular workout and low impact on your joints. Water Waves is a healthy way to cool off in the summer, socialise amongst others and a great way to strengthen all major muscle groups.
